Triple J (2019)

Provincewide, Alberta | (230 engineers, pipefitters, labourers) and the Construction Workers Union, CLAC Local 63

Renewal agreement: Effective June 1, 2023 to May 31, 2025. Signed on June 1, 2023.

Paid holidays: 11 days.

Vacations with pay: All employees will receive 6% of earnings in vacation pay on each pay period. Employer will consider vacations at times requested considering business requirements.

Overtime: Time and one-half for all hours worked after 8 regular straight-time hours per day and 40 regular straight-time hours per week.

Medical benefits: CLAC Health and Welfare Trust Fund.

STD: Coverage of 60% of weekly earnings, maximum $700 per week.

LTD: Coverage of 60% of weekly earnings, maximum $3,000 per month.

AD&D: Coverage of $100,000.

Life insurance: Coverage of $100,000.

Pension: CLAC group RSP.

Bereavement leave: 3 days for death of adult interdependent partner, child, legal adult dependent, father, mother, parents in law, legal guardian, brother, sister.

Probationary period: 2 months.

Uniforms/clothing: All employees will wear CSA-approved safety hats, gloves, safety equipment (including safety glasses, fire retardant coveralls), raingear, if and when required, to be made available by employer.

Mileage: $0.70 per kilometre (previously $0.55 per kilometre), minimum travel 300 kilometres, paid to employee as travel allowance. $0.95 per kilometre (previously $0.80 per kilometre) for employees whose classification requires use of own vehicle in performance of duties.

Sample rates of hourly pay (current):

For 16-24 inch pipes

Welder w/ rig: $112.58

Welder utility w/ rig: $102.58

Mechanic w/ rig: $112.58

Straw boss 1 (pipe gang): $40.81

Operator group 1: $40.81

Operator group 4: $30.06

Driver group 3: $36.44

Driver group 4: $30.06

Labour skilled: $27.82

Labour general: $22.28

Sandblaster/coater: $36.44

Mechanic: $41.83

Welder: $41.83

Spacer: $39.75

Stabber: $29.15

Bead grinder: $28.52

Automatic technician: $38.43

Editor’s notes: Employer-owned vehicles: $35 per day for all employees (foreman, straw boss are excluded) who operate employer-owned pick-up, crew cab, vans which regularly transports other employees and who fuel, clean and inspect vehicle outside of work hours. Union-management meetings: For those held during regular working hours, employee will be paid regular hourly rate. $50 flat fee if meetings are held outside of regular working hours. Fresh-air hoods: Employer will pay (1-time application) for journeyman welders who operate mechanized welder to be reimbursed 50% of cost of fresh-air hood, maximum $1,000.
